Sylvester Stallone Tapped by Trump for NEA Chairman
newsbusters ^ | 12/15/2016 | Maggie McKneely

Posted on 12/15/2016 12:30:42 PM PST by DFG

Donald Trump has an idea about how to make art great again – by tapping ‘Rocky’ to head the National Endowment for the Arts.

DailyMail.com is reporting that Stallone is the first name Trump has floated for the top arts position. Sylvester Stallone, known for his roles as Rocky Balboa and Rambo, is reportedly excited by the idea, though the job has not been formally offered to him yet.
